The ten flip-flops are edge-triggered D-type flip-flops. On the positive
transition of the clock (CLK) input, the device provides true data at the Q
outputs.
A buffered output-enable (OE) input can be used to place the ten outputs
in either a normal logic state (high or low logic levels) or a high-impedance
state. In the high-impedance state, the outputs neither load nor drive the bus
lines significantly. The high-impedance state and increased drive provide
the capability to drive bus lines without interface or pullup components.
OE
does not affect the internal operations of the latch. Previously stored data can
be retained or new data can be entered while the outputs are in the high-
impedance state.
The LVC821A has been designed with a ±24mA output driver. This
driver is capable of driving a moderate to heavy load while maintaining
speed performance.
To ensure the high-impedance state during power up or power down,
OE
should be tied to V
CC
through a pullup resistor; the minimum value of the
resistor is determined by the current-sinking capability of the driver.
Inputs can be driven from either 3.3V or 5V devices. This feature allows
the use of this device as a translator in a mixed 3.3V/5V system environment.

DESCRIPTION:
The LVC821A 10-bit bus-interface flip-flop is built using advanced dual
metal CMOS technology. The LVC821A device features 3-state outputs
designed specifically for driving highly capacitive or relatively low-imped-
